Account recovery — Pinwheel address autocomplete widget. If the widget's service account is locked (symptom: autocomplete returns empty, logs show auth_denied), do not recreate the account; it's bound to the suggestion index. Steps: confirm lockout in the Brindle console, file the recovery request, wait for the 10-minute cooldown, then re-auth the widget from the maintainer shell. Suggestion cache rebuilds automatically after re-auth; allow 15 minutes. The recovery flow prompts for the passphrase below.

strongbox words: ulaael-wenix

Handing over the Moonpool tide-table widget to you. The predictions come from the Selkie harmonic service; we cache twelve hours ahead and refresh at 02:00. Watch the Brackwater station feed — it occasionally sends duplicate timestamps, which the dedupe pass in TideMerge handles, but verify after any deploy. Charts render via Shoreline.js, pinned to v4. Architecture notes, known quirks, and the refresh schedule are all on the internal page here:

wiki page, tahaf-tajog: https://jira.ordindyn.corp/pipeline

Ticket #FAC-LOSTBADGE. Reporter: Dena Korlov, Verrant Systems, Floor 3. Badge lost somewhere between the canteen and Pillar Court entrance. Deactivate old badge immediately. Issue temporary day pass, max 48 hours, logbook entry required. Escort not needed — staff member is known to reception. Until replacement arrives, she may use the side-door code below.

turnstile pass: bdg-TXR-4

Ticket #4182 — Digest emails not firing on staging

The Mailwren digest scheduler on the Pelton staging box skipped all three batch windows last night. Root cause: the environment was cloned from the demo stack, so the cron toggle is off and the signing credential is missing entirely. Set DIGEST_CRON_ENABLED=true in /etc/mailwren/env, then add the signing secret on the next line.

sealed setting: ARCHIVE_KEY3=8d0